Brian Clements
1e46e955c9
Omaha #4216 ebxml thrift service is handled by request-service endpoint
...
Change-Id: If7e0c99b89e021150cfb57d7cbd4a0ec3cba0e86
Conflicts:
edexOsgi/com.raytheon.uf.edex.registry.ebxml/modes/ebxml-modes.xml
Former-commit-id: 5883cde7ca0989326957721e0aea70560911450d
2015-10-29 14:53:26 -05:00
Dave Hladky
3a9febd758
Omaha #4774 Fixed deployment bug for DD and HS
...
Change-Id: I76b34d0f0f657b11990f5fd1a9d77733b48791e2
Former-commit-id: ac5a683b9a945c88fbb8a10ac7a363e335a71941
2015-08-24 15:23:49 -05:00
Benjamin Phillippe
158d23017a
Omaha #4448 Added default user to registry
...
Change-Id: Ic48ed87bdd7ad16bc6dfd46725822cd0da13d725
Former-commit-id: f177e1bea6e245d1eed8defd0186a213f5727d0f
2015-06-01 14:40:39 -05:00
Benjamin Phillippe
baaebd737b
Omaha #4448 Separated registry from Data Delivery
...
Change-Id: I8d59db901f5cceaf64fb5cdd560ea4c82dc07685
Former-commit-id: 0304538b64ff5e8c604900ab68a4a2cace8fa642
2015-05-28 13:45:45 -05:00
Dave Hladky
0a92be1e97
Omaha #4493 transaction integrity of external delivery
...
Former-commit-id: 70070c21b6aad7493316b562094d64eadf961536
2015-05-18 11:03:29 -05:00
Nate Jensen
939ac73a13
Omaha #3978 fix http ebxml thrift service
...
Change-Id: I50e57fcafd472cbfd72fc911e863e118a62ab5ba
Former-commit-id: 6fca25e457989f4757999cfcce40ff9a3b1fc393
2015-03-03 17:20:25 -06:00
Brian Clements
87e4d0aada
Omaha #3789 moved common.http to ufcore, reworked camel http endpoints
...
Change-Id: Ie1363cb5198c3d90129f5d46465883234f06c58e
Former-commit-id: d81c8f6708e25c93df3dd199293d47f326dea61a
2015-01-08 14:50:36 -06:00
Max Schenkelberg
78b87b7a63
Omaha #3541 Fixed ebxml copy of request service endpoint and moved http service path to setup.env
...
Change-Id: I05abe29c7df0b22026547f2e89b5074281f1a7ea
Former-commit-id: 3aff99e787a7368f40cdd161581ead2d3552118c
2014-08-26 11:32:20 -05:00
Richard Peter
651a10715a
Merge "Omaha #3541 Updated A2 baseline to reflect request service split" into omaha_14.4.1
...
Former-commit-id: e2ed1054e382de6e3656fd9335dedc5af3692c17
2014-08-25 20:43:28 -05:00
Max Schenkelberg
e90bdb6fce
Omaha #3541 Updated A2 baseline to reflect request service split
...
Change-Id: Iaa540397b6723a61841d93baf655be87701d9c93
Former-commit-id: e6b16ea30563c0afdd48822e8efc9faabadef8f0
2014-08-22 13:15:42 -05:00
Benjamin Phillippe
02719e9f90
Omaha #3509 Fixed XACML processing to work properly with DPA
...
Change-Id: I6b66cfe4217c8a9bc2dec1d7e97b7f5203b518fe
Former-commit-id: 4661d8ec3ed187b2ccf270a2acbcd55cc5ef359c
2014-08-20 09:30:16 -05:00
Benjamin Phillippe
ca6c4093b7
Omaha #3509 Minor fixes to custom XACML policy processing
...
Former-commit-id: 21efa23f4c1236e874312c03a60f5c6dc2bd0c9a
2014-08-13 11:09:30 -05:00
Benjamin Phillippe
e9c310b4d8
Omaha #3509 Aded support for custom XACML policies
...
Change-Id: I37c0aac34cbcc30be2a48876cef27cdf97c35a33
Former-commit-id: 1b1cd7789f835fd73dbc0d939df03f6417600154
2014-08-12 10:31:49 -05:00
Benjamin Phillippe
81997a24cc
Omaha #3255 Fixing dependencies to fix the DPA
...
Change-Id: If2625cda7b73b52b6e79f3a6b8ac580dbcf1ecc9
Former-commit-id: 075bb856689e8eaa95ee7721b6270c3a785c9bd4
2014-07-24 11:27:27 -05:00
Benjamin Phillippe
6cb73e63a1
Omaha #3350 Added user/role authentication. Added XACML authorization
...
Change-Id: Id307fdc04ba7a74c9e81650c7b4ba272405cf6df
Former-commit-id: 81d0249971d4004067b6aef672e00417ddb83b36
2014-07-16 10:49:24 -05:00
Benjamin Phillippe
7960578e2c
Omaha #3350 Removing OBE classes/files for registry user registry and identity management
...
Former-commit-id: b81d5e3de415fb08b83d76aafacfef2ca937115c
2014-07-03 12:53:22 -05:00
Dave Hladky
0d1767a3d7
Omaha #2760 Made external JMS route for registry events
...
Change-Id: I8ff1af48468896dadd41bdcf8a6e6e7bc24c9eb6
Former-commit-id: 22e51bc1f882c535c7bafcdfd84428700eb6e547
2014-06-27 10:04:17 -05:00
Dave Hladky
dbf301b8c4
Omaha #3273 Remove all reference off DD env variables from setup.env
...
Former-commit-id: 0ad525e949fc9cf9390909128b4c590034f00963
2014-06-26 09:46:31 -05:00
Dave Hladky
47cc398e91
Omaha #3306 Made DPA SSL comms work
...
Change-Id: I4ef3086f4abadf35c910386c823c914c7892156d
Former-commit-id: 9061033cd5f8299435b5aa83410e2d99f477d07e
2014-06-23 13:03:25 -05:00
Nate Jensen
3c57231c82
Omaha #3255 attempt to fix build
...
Change-Id: I8b21eaebaa60a7051ccbc9d12d33df742c471f25
Former-commit-id: 4e8c5f881272ed8d7aea30cd8316ebcbdd2443c3
2014-06-17 08:42:29 -05:00
Nate Jensen
c65c392d63
Omaha #3255 fix build
...
Change-Id: I0bff28eb7d430c7a789539a76c893ecf0a64ac46
Former-commit-id: 579cef6ab063bae1df0cfe85411d174dc75b08bd
2014-06-17 07:40:18 -05:00
Benjamin Phillippe
fb9e936e0e
Omaha #3255 Registry Security Features (commit 1/5)
...
Change-Id: I3b24ae8696ded86d8157a092eeff81cc45a2f291
Former-commit-id: ec1b81d28c4b418fada53c684e78d397fee9b97d
2014-06-12 11:26:51 -05:00
Nate Jensen
08c5c75035
Omaha #3211 fix data delivery modes
...
Change-Id: I06fede8fd63e0a71f5532e8124bf919faf62612e
Former-commit-id: 630f2fab4c3c37fd05eb9f92d14c11cf761d9477
2014-06-09 14:34:18 -05:00
Dave Hladky
3b00ae03cc
Issue #2992 Updated DD list of active registries
...
Change-Id: Iaef7dc76442d1e101cf9865a542a777afe1722ca
Former-commit-id: a34955102d1316135c4151210daba0e5807ff6c9
2014-04-30 17:38:28 -05:00
Richard Peter
32957285fc
Merge branch 'master_14.3.1' (14.3.1-2) into omaha_14.3.1
...
Conflicts:
cave/com.raytheon.uf.viz.archive/src/com/raytheon/uf/viz/archive/ui/CaseCreationDlg.java
cave/com.raytheon.uf.viz.archive/src/com/raytheon/uf/viz/archive/ui/GenerateCaseDlg.java
edexOsgi/com.raytheon.edex.plugin.gfe/utility/edex_static/base/config/gfe/serverConfig.py
edexOsgi/com.raytheon.edex.utilitysrv/res/spring/utility-request.xml
edexOsgi/com.raytheon.uf.common.colormap/src/com/raytheon/uf/common/colormap/image/Colormapper.java
edexOsgi/com.raytheon.uf.common.serialization/src/com/raytheon/uf/common/serialization/SerializationUtil.java
edexOsgi/com.raytheon.uf.edex.textdbsrv/res/spring/textdbsrv-request.xml
Change-Id: I316979d4036b2e2d05b361c8c466747b04ee4900
Former-commit-id: 311c52426b3715d3a73c1fa79a8fd427a4b1b09d
2014-04-28 16:27:40 -05:00
Richard Peter
341e8331db
Issue #2928 : Add default byte limit, set registry byte limit
...
Change-Id: I31f6687b30f501a30f78d4b289059d2de19528f6
Former-commit-id: e32d44051831d9b587ab398a19eb5afe7b7b5c58
2014-04-22 15:08:18 -05:00
Benjamin Phillippe
62062bf288
Issue #3011 Fixed replication slowdown
...
Change-Id: I176d5080a5ccd533099c8f84a779b9d6f8340109
Former-commit-id: 92c584179ddbad65c115092d3bf82ca6fe114b09
2014-04-15 09:15:12 -05:00
Richard Peter
17196b5dcd
Issue #2726 : Edex graceful shutdown.
...
Refactored to use inheritance and separate logic where possible.
Addressed comments.
Change-Id: I9e62414cd83121575bdf99a3b47466a7585bedb6
Former-commit-id: 6e015b3f61c20635077d6e8271e9b763e5a32fe1
2014-04-14 13:10:11 -05:00
Benjamin Phillippe
5483d6d7ae
Issue #2769 : Registry database deadlocking fixes/performance improvements
...
Change-Id: I7a1a0b5397ff179d60d7303f2f22e4cd95940df0
Former-commit-id: a4e02448e88b8b0bbad62794b41d0ef1bd1c6b6e
2014-03-03 10:57:16 -06:00
Dave Hladky
45413d0db4
Issue #2469 Fixed default rules implementation
...
Former-commit-id: 9f5d3a8fefb7c9977533c8c3770e14e5a5e09f72
2014-02-24 13:06:52 -06:00
Benjamin Phillippe
95b0f12880
Issue #2613 Registry performance enhancements. Better handling of delete events.
...
Change-Id: I56d3f5c37778e717810b6a698ec9405ed3cde00a
Former-commit-id: f863897fd512acae11364eb6b4737339b5951da0
2014-01-21 15:02:59 -06:00
Benjamin Phillippe
83bec75737
Issue #2613 Registry peformance enhancements
...
-- Added indexes to registry tables
-- Better cleanup when a registry leaves the federation
-- Batching of queries in notification handler to reduce number of web service calls
-- Added Hibernate flushes and clears to better manage memory
Change-Id: I88ec580694d2104458391a798667748c88f16dd0
Former-commit-id: 4344ffec77286a531b9be29e9ef94acd9c6ce342
2014-01-15 16:09:13 -06:00
Benjamin Phillippe
0cb4e61261
Issue #2613 Registry performance enhancements
...
Change-Id: Id50678b2af78adff17fe622201a65d5530e68c21
Former-commit-id: 8d62013d772cf3a15b8f0fa2be7d80955dbfd74d
2013-12-11 12:20:12 -06:00
Benjamin Phillippe
ed77440c28
Issue #1829 Refactored EBXML registry objects
...
Change-Id: I0f1b2ecbac19cdc2304680d4dbdfb5d963f0649d
Former-commit-id: 6eb387e69c2fc4837b58f99e4343a745162fb384
2013-12-05 10:20:24 -06:00
Dave Hladky
593f24023d
Issue #1736 Add registry bandwidth tracking
...
Change-Id: Ic8b2a845095482aa117289c3fd68cd20b1bb87e6
Former-commit-id: 695365c03ac142960a22e6774f3a10fd5e16cd35
2013-12-04 11:58:49 -06:00
Benjamin Phillippe
31b53f4ad9
Issue #2534 Added reciprocated registry replication subscriptions
...
Change-Id: I6844d65ccab6c4246f37ce212fa17af09851da27
Former-commit-id: 2c52a6ee6f7d491d484c423359b8440975ad6d1e
2013-11-27 12:07:59 -06:00
Benjamin Phillippe
d8de923f8b
Issue #1538 Moved data delivery specific web services out of registry plugins
...
-- Added registry federation admin page
-- Made registry service clients non-static
Change-Id: I9672f11b4886019dcd8834b4bae417a0aa4809ad
Former-commit-id: 0a67c8d68548ed8daa76d782ca3213956b984795
2013-11-01 09:20:00 -05:00
Richard Peter
1750224476
Merge "Issue #1538 Fixes/cleanup to registry. Changed auditable event type sent time to DateTime instead of integer" into development
...
Former-commit-id: 381be8f02831002b29a8a90831b1c116d023c48f
2013-10-23 16:53:22 -05:00
Benjamin Phillippe
68eeb03630
Issue #1538 Fixes/cleanup to registry. Changed auditable event type sent time to DateTime instead of integer
...
Change-Id: I2d22199f9e1e35b3425e294ce3884ebb9d2cc99f
Former-commit-id: 18737abc6781a353b831d9c012cc293f60731f89
2013-10-23 11:05:38 -05:00
Benjamin Phillippe
ef0d0e2393
Issue #1538 Reworked registry database connection strategy
...
Change-Id: I6c8a18946ec9cecbd91ac5fbc48407841f28e7ae
Former-commit-id: e9e4d1ae4bbe6098f637dbca64f684c90313d478
2013-10-23 10:48:40 -05:00
Benjamin Phillippe
d94f22fda8
Issue #1682 Fixed replication/query errors and added synchronous notification delivery
...
Change-Id: Ia6a07c3abf6c48ef18d354dc2866ed981e6f1478
Former-commit-id: 2f6dc771e86cf290bb72743f1855f02c616e57d5
2013-10-20 16:02:10 -05:00
Benjamin Phillippe
ed23a786d6
Issue #1682 Refactored Registry querying to conform to EBXML 4.0 spec
...
Change-Id: If6d3579305afbb279057a264033736fc126b7849
Former-commit-id: 5112ee9931a1678fee37dd725a28dd6fff1e7ec9
2013-10-18 09:20:40 -05:00
Benjamin Phillippe
df32d5e2e3
Issue #1705 Added support for registry object references
...
Change-Id: If489dcf41f02257ceb31bab1f5a917c3e6884252
Former-commit-id: a1b3a525cafd0759dfed9a387f74649bb4a3a765
2013-09-18 10:58:54 -05:00
Benjamin Phillippe
b10ecfa19c
Issue #1538 Federated registry fixes/modifications
...
Change-Id: Iedc048fe42687bec17385f0aacf0af0141df2146
Former-commit-id: 05e0a84c1ef3d04256884b81219f643e8f38187d
2013-08-28 11:41:06 -05:00
Benjamin Phillippe
1390bd8a65
Issue #1692 Implemented/Verified Registry LifecycleManager
...
- Verified submitObjects protocol
- Added unimplemented features of removeObjects protocol
- Implemented updateObjects protocol
- Refactored registry error reporting
- Fixed JUnit tests
- Corrected @XmlRootElement tag on registry objects
- Added capability to modify registry objects using XPath
Change-Id: Id8eea47c3c4a1e39fe88cb17530e9e6cdacd7ce2
Former-commit-id: 94810246b449c64457c48684df72baf6e9e8b03d
2013-08-19 13:16:13 -05:00
Benjamin Phillippe
5bd0d92363
Issue #1693 Modified Submit objects to conform to 4.0 spec. Added remote object references and some cleanup
...
Change-Id: I0f4eafb3fa68f2d1eeade4f047c95d714502cf56
Former-commit-id: 2aa7bdc1a8a942eaa0589527e8987b6fc518479f
2013-08-06 11:13:01 -05:00
Benjamin Phillippe
3396e5a620
Issue #2191 Registry federation synchronization and garbage collection
...
Change-Id: Ie17468d90c5c1a2f1b708d6e69edd2d026e17633
Former-commit-id: b8930f3c76f6285627aa54307f08fd28c627a4b2
2013-07-30 09:37:41 -05:00
Dustin Johnson
95b61618fe
Issue #2195 Remove Spring name= use in constructor args
...
Change-Id: I00745ce0cc04ed9c7d0497063668ad127357d17d
Former-commit-id: 2ce8e4ebf5f67998c25cdb33ab44e169e73471b2
2013-07-15 13:20:44 -05:00
Benjamin Phillippe
34764a4a09
Issue #2191 : Registry Garbage Collection
...
Change-Id: I15094a928b4f8793daab751b85a20b19b6352438
Former-commit-id: 6afda27e19d0ea38c547afc9a28c55525706f9f1
2013-07-12 11:33:21 -05:00
Dustin Johnson
69c09e530f
Issue #2106 Fix transactional semantics
...
- No longer continuously suspend/resume transactions caused by invoking static methods
- Mark registry top-level query/store classes as requiring existing transactions
- Invoke registry initialized listeners in their own transaction
- Data changes denoted by registry events are now visible when the transaction commits
Change-Id: Ic78cbf00afc93aa5fcf1357000ea6c8b5e32cea9
Former-commit-id: 8d1a47446927a3c6646fa0748d7096afb376b952
2013-06-25 08:33:55 -05:00